Fatigue crack propagation:

If it is assumed that no plastic deformation occurs around crack tip and law of fatigue crack propagation for place of above Example is da/dN =  10- 8 (Δ KI eff )2.0 mm/cycle , find after how many cycles the plate will fracture.

Solution

Δ K I = ΔK I eff     because there is no plastic deformation in crack tip neighbourhood.

1926_Fatigue crack propagation.png

ac = 146.14 mm, ai = 35 mm from above Example .

or, Nf   =2´104 ln ( ac/ ai) =  2´104 ln (146.14/35)

or, N f  = 2´104 ln (4.175) = 28584 cycles
